Transaction d6613591410f7702fe6f601b3dc0819f793321f502d38750583d5cf81126946d
2 Input
2 Outputs
- d6613591410f7702fe6f601b3dc0819f793321f502d38750583d5cf81126946d:0
- d6613591410f7702fe6f601b3dc0819f793321f502d38750583d5cf81126946d:1
value 42656
address 1Fiu6j6B7eS4cHSFvAftdXRkQsS2oaArE
value 18500000
address 16X2JFqepfD6gruLrMA4ykubG19zmcD6NB